Abstract

December usually means the beginning of frost. But this does not mean that concrete paving should be put on hold in sub-zero temperatures. The new approach to molding with ultra-fine materials, supported by the active development of new admix-tours, has paved the way for amazing advances in concrete technology in recent years. The rapid development of concrete technology makes it possible to easily prepare high-performance concrete. The question arises whether high-performance concrete can be created at low temperatures. Other examples in civil engineering realized in sub-zero temperatures also suggest this question.
